Japan becoming danger to peace, stability in East Asia
0
SHARES
289
VIEWS

Islamabad: Japan is becoming the biggest hidden danger to peace and stability in East Asia, claimed the Global Time owing to its gradual shift from economic development to military expansion.

The Chinese ‘Global Times’ editorial took a dig at the Japans over ambitious military expansionism and the United States interventionist policies to use the region for its own strategic purposes.

“Not long ago, Japan’s ruling Liberal Democratic Party proposed to increase the proportion of GDP for defense spending from 1 percent to 2 percent within five years. Japan has been propagating and emphasizing its “unease.” This, in turn, also makes Japan’s neighboring countries feel puzzled and uneasy,” the GT editorial read.

GT is seen as the official word of the Chinese establishment as is keenly watched over by experts.

“Japan,” GT said, ‘which has gradually shifted its national focus from economic development to military expansion, is becoming the biggest hidden danger to peace and stability in East Asia.’

The editorial cites the recent discussion of Japan’s ruling leaders and opposition parties including Prime Minister Fumio Kishida, on TV whether Japan should consider acquiring a nuclear-powered submarine.


“Given the overall operations conducted by Washington, the real dangers of Japanese right-wing forces are obscured. Japan is the only country in the world that dares to openly deny the history of its aggression in World War II, but the US has kept endorsing Japan’s ambitions out of its own geopolitical self-interests. It hopes that Japan could keep the ability to bark at China frequently, even bite when necessary, while it takes Japan under its own control confidently,” the editorial warns. Taking a dig at US-Japan relations GT editorial warns that the ‘US does not care if Japan is smashed to pieces in the geopolitical collision, while Japan wants to use the US’ selfishness to achieve its purpose of completely unleashing its military and political restrictions, which has become a dangerous scheme of theirs.’
